Great Snacks To Eat After Workout
The Benefits of Eating After Workout
After a good workout, your body needs to replenish its energy stores so you can maintain your strength and build muscle. Eating the right snacks after a workout can help your body restore its energy and can be beneficial to your overall health. Eating after a workout can help keep your blood sugar levels stable, which can help you stay focused and energized throughout the day. Eating the right snacks after a workout can also help you build muscle, burn fat and stay hydrated.
Best Snacks To Eat After Workout
There are a variety of great snacks that you can eat after a workout to help restore your energy and keep you healthy. Here are some of the best snacks to eat after a workout:
1. Protein Shakes
Protein shakes are a great way to replenish your energy stores after a workout. Protein shakes can help your body recover and build muscle. Protein shakes are also a convenient way to get your daily dose of protein without having to cook or prepare a meal. When choosing a protein shake, look for one that is low in sugar and contains a high-quality protein source, such as whey or plant-based protein.
2. Yogurt
Yogurt is a great source of protein and can help replenish your energy stores after a workout. Yogurt also contains probiotics, which are beneficial for your digestive health. Look for yogurt that is low in sugar and contains live and active cultures. Greek yogurt is a great option as it is higher in protein than regular yogurt.
3. Fruit
Fruit is a great snack to eat after a workout. Fruit is a great source of natural sugars, which can help replenish your energy stores. Fruits are also high in vitamins, minerals, and fiber, which can help keep you healthy. Fruits such as apples, oranges, bananas, and berries are all great options.
4. Nuts and Seeds
Nuts and seeds are great snacks to eat after a workout. Nuts and seeds are high in protein and healthy fats, which can help your body recover and build muscle. Nuts and seeds are also a great source of vitamins, minerals, and fiber. Almonds, walnuts, chia seeds, and flax seeds are all great options.
5. Hummus and Veggies
Hummus and veggies make a great snack after a workout. Hummus is a great source of plant-based protein and healthy fats, which can help your body recover and build muscle. Veggies are also a great source of vitamins, minerals, and fiber. Carrots, celery, and bell peppers are all great options to dip in hummus.
6. Chocolate Milk
Chocolate milk is a great post-workout snack. Chocolate milk contains carbohydrates and protein, which can help replenish your energy stores and build muscle. Chocolate milk is also a great source of calcium and vitamin D, which can help keep your bones strong and healthy. Look for low-fat chocolate milk that is low in sugar.
